Video Tour: Cultural Landmarks of New York City

The Historic Districts Council (HDC) chose Cultural Landmarks as one of the 2018 Six to Celebrate (STC) to shine a light on sites of cultural significance throughout the five boroughs. HDC hopes to broaden the conversation about preservation tools for culturally significant sites and to create an action plan for their proper stewardship. Instead of doing the usual tour series for the Cultural Sites we decided to produce a series of videos. We chose one site in each borough to highlight varies types of cultural importance.

These films were produced as part of HDC’s Six to Celebrate Cultural Landmarks initiative, which examines unprotected sites of cultural significance throughout the five boroughs.
